Output 48332102139bb4e85e51796c87b4fcedc4c467b28a95d4f9fbf1afa74640d804:0

value
46714221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d16499dbd509eb625c897df6f3c6e1ce8c08afa OP_EQUAL
address
3BdpH28ZgCcDfScrE83zwAhhcS7xzQS2dK
transaction
48332102139bb4e85e51796c87b4fcedc4c467b28a95d4f9fbf1afa74640d804
confirmations
344262
spent
true